We Take Our Financial Accountability Seriously

We are transparent in our financial practices, so you can see how your gifts are being used to help the lost, the poor, and the homeless in our local community and around the world. We use your gifts in the area, project, or city that you specify. If gifts received are above a specific need, they will be used where the need is greatest.

We are committed to the highest standards of financial accountability. We adhere to the guidelines set forth by the Evangelical Council of Financial Accountability (ECFA) and undergo an annual, outside audit. We work diligently to limit overhead costs while maximizing the opportunities and effectiveness of our programs. We are supported by individuals, foundations, corporations, churches and other organizations.
 

In 2021, $.78 of every dollar went directly to our programs
that benefit men, women, children, and communities.
